Description

A very charming architect designed property built in the 1960’s, Dormy Croft is replete with Mid Century features including a stone fireplace surround, wood panelling and stone cladding. Sharp lines and large windows create a modern, angular feel, promoting excellent natural light. While this much-loved family home is somewhat dated internally, it presents a fantastic opportunity for modernisation and personalisation. The spacious layout includes an extension and there is scope to extend further if desired, subject to obtaining the necessary consents. The ground floor accommodation comprises an open plan sitting/dining room and conservatory, a separate kitchen and breakfast room with adjoining utility for laundry machines, a study – which would equally make a great second reception room, and a shower room with WC. Upstairs there are three good sized bedrooms, two with double aspect windows including a principal bedroom with built-in wardrobes and an en suite shower room, plus a further family bathroom.

Dormy Croft is tucked away on a quiet private cul-de sac to the east of central Cookham, bordered by open countryside to the south with good access to local footpaths and bridleways. The property sits within a mature plot enveloped by well-established trees and shrubs affording a high degree of privacy, with the fencing to the rear garden allowing lovely unobstructed views over the surrounding fields and paddocks beyond. The house is approached via a block-paved driveway which leads up to a detached garage, with storage or potting space at the rear. The garden envelops the west and south of the house and is laid to lawn, with shrubs and flowerbeds around the borders and a pretty pond creating textural and colourful interest. An elevated south facing terrace, accessed from the conservatory, provides a sunny space for outdoor entertaining.

Location

Danes Gardens is a pleasant cul de sac to the east of Cookham village, with excellent access to amenities. Cookham is set within glorious rolling countryside in a designated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. There are scenic walks along the Thames Path and within the surrounding woodland, with golf, football, cricket and rugby clubs nearby.

There are three primary schools and three nursery schools situated in Cookham, with a comprehensive range of private and state schooling options in the area include Sir William Borlase's Grammar School, Beaconsfield High School, Eton, Harrow, Wycombe Abbey, Caldicot Preparatory School and some excellent schools in the Maidenhead, Marlow and Henley area.

Cookham is delightfully rural, yet perfectly positioned for access to both Marlow and Maidenhead where you will find a more extensive mix of bars, cafés and restaurants, as well as an eclectic range of local independent and national retailers.

For commuters, Cookham has a train station with a service to Paddington (via Maidenhead) in as little as 31 minutes, with an Elizabeth Line connection into central London from Maidenhead. The M40 and M4 motorways are easily accessible via the A404(M).
